[Isolation of Leishmania major Yakimoff and Shokhor, 1914 (Kinetoplastida-Trypanosomatidae) in Meriones shawi-shawi (Duvernoy, 1842) (Rodentia-Gerbillidae) in Tunisia].

J A Rioux, F Petter, A Zahaf, G Lanotte, R Houin, D Jarry, J Perieres, A Martini, S Sarhani.   

Abstract

Leishmania major, agent of zoonotic cutaneous leishmaniasis, has been isolated from the rodent Meriones shawi shawi in central Tunisia. As a result, the North saharan arid mediterranean area can be considered as epidemiologically homogeneous.
